The Cambridge Room at House of Blues in Dallas is a hidden gem that’s really shaped the local live music scene over the years. It’s not just a small room; it’s a space that packs a punch with its killer sound and lighting setups that make every note feel alive. You can catch everything from intimate acoustic sets, like the local singer-songwriters night back in 2007, to high-energy performances that make the walls vibrate. What really sets it apart is the vibe, there’s often pre-show parties that turn into fun little gatherings, giving fans a chance to mingle and get hyped before the music kicks in. The stage is versatile enough for all kinds of acts, and the mezzanine seating offers a sweet spot to soak in the show from above if you’re into a more relaxed view.
